Interventions
DRUG

3% hypertonic Saline

"the patients received 3% HS at the rate of 4 mL/kg for 30 minutes. the intervention period for the study ran for the first hour of treatment, and serial monitoring and lab tests were done during this period, measurement lactate levels will done at 0, 30, 60 mins and 24 hour, the ABG parameters were recorded 30 and 60 min after the completion of the calculated dose infused with fluids and serial monitoring of vital parameters was done at 0, 15, 30, and 60 mins. The lactate clearance was calculated as follows:~-hour lactate clearance (%) = (0-hour lactate - 1-hour lactate) / 0-hour lactate × 100"
